How to Patch a Plaster Pool . Pool shells commonly have a layer of plaster over concrete or gunite. Over time the plaster cracks or chips from wear, contact with heavy or sharp objects or becoming dried out from too much sun exposure. Doing the job yourself saves thousands of dollars for the patching alone, not including the considerable cost of cleaning and preparations for professional patching. Wear protective clothing and rubber boots. Put on your rubber gloves, safety goggles and respirator. Fill a 5- gallon bucket with soda ash, and place it near the lowest point in the pool. ![]() Leave room for the acid water to pool around the drain without blocking your access to the bucket. Chisel out loose plaster from cracks, pop outs and hollow spots in the pool. Detect hollow spots by dragging a heavy chain across the bottom of the pool. Listen closely as you drag for a hollow, echo- like sound that indicates the location of a hollow spot. Grind cracks to 1/2 inch deep with a grinder. Continue grinding to extend the crack 1 inch on each end. Allow the crack to dry. Scrub the dust and debris out of the cracks and chiseled areas using a wire brush. Hook up a garden hose to your outdoor water tap. Rinse the sides of the pool as it finishes draining to remove loose debris, such as leaves and algae. Shovel out the debris, and drain the rinse water. Leave the water hose running, and lay the hose along the bottom of the pool. Pour 1 gallon of water into a plastic sprayer, then add 1 gallon of muriatic acid. Place the lid on the container. Start at the deepest end of the pool, and spray one 5- foot section of wall at a time with the acid. Let the acid sit for 3. Mix more acid as needed to finish the pool. Add 2 pounds of soda ash for each gallon of acid used to the acid water in the bottom of the pool to neutralize the acid. Stir the soda ash into the water with a pool brush on an extension pole. Drain the water out of the pool. Let the pool dry out completely. Spread a bead of self- leveling pool caulk along the crack. Let it dry for 1. Mix the plaster patching compound with water to the consistency of peanut butter. Continue mixing until no lumps or powder remain, scraping the sides of the container as you stir. Mist the surface of the crack with a spray bottle filled with water. Spray just enough that the surface becomes moist but water does not bead up. Pick up a dollop of the plaster patching compound with the flat trowel. Drag it across the crack at a 4. After filling a few feet of the crack, drag the trowel down the length of the crack to smooth it out. If the plaster skims over while you work, simply stir it again to make it workable. Dab a sponge against the patch to match the texture to the surrounding wall. Continue packing the crack this way until you have it filled. Cover each patch with a wet towel to keep it moist while you finish patching all damaged areas. Remove the towels once you finish patching. Fill the pool immediately. Things You Will Need.
